Martinsville NJ and Livingston, NJ, February 15, 2015 — Reflections Center for Skin & Body (www.reflectionscenter.com) notes that our skin loses volume and becomes thinner as we age. This natural process causes cheeks to sag, skin folds around the nose to become deeper, and the increased appearance of lines and wrinkles.

“Fortunately, there are many different dermal fillers that can be used to restore lost volume to the skin precisely where it’s needed,” said Dr. Mitchell Chasin, Medical Director of Reflections Center for Skin & Body. “The reason we use so many dermal fillers is because each has it’s own special strength and is used in different areas of the face,” he explained.

According to Dr. Chasin, he might use a dermal filler like Juvederm Voluma to restore volume to the cheeks, while another dermal filler like Restylane works well to reduce the nasolabial folds. Still another dermal filler like Belotero Balance can be used for the fine lines around the mouth and the eyes. It’s all about matching the right dermal filler to the specific needs of the patient.

And it’s all about comfort. One thing the physicians at Reflections Center do differently than most other practices is that they inject dermal fillers using a flexible cannula, a tiny little tube that makes injections more comfortable and doesn’t tend to bruise the skin the way a syringe does.
